ClamWin can not fix most false positives. ClamWin uses the free, open source engine from Clam AV (owned by Cisco). Clam AV is responsible for the scanning code and the virus signatures and needs to fix any false positives detected by its signatures.
Clam Av is the only one who can fix most false positives. Until Clam AV fixes a FP, ClamWin users can only exclude the file from scanning with ClamWin via using menu item: Tools, Preferences, Filters, Exclude Matching File Names. If ClamWin detects a file, and it is not detected on Virus Total by Clam AV as infected, that is a ClamWin problem--let us know about that. I am seeing a few FPs like that lately--which means that ClamWin needs to update to the latest Clam AV source code version to fix it. I have told the developers about these ClamWin only FPs. I have been finding lately some that some files are being detected by ClamWin with a false positive message to submit the file to Clam Av for signature correction. The problem is that Clam Av does not detect the file on Virus Total. The detection is probably due to ClamWin not being able to process a signature correctly because it does not have the latest Clam AV scan code that properly handles the signature. Here's hoping the ClamWin developers can/will give us a current version Windows port of ClamAV.
